Wire cutting clamp for steel ball and steel bar
Technical Field
The utility model relates to a wire-electrode cutting anchor clamps, especially a wire-electrode cutting anchor clamps for steel ball rod iron.
Background
Wear-resisting steel ball, rod iron often need the section to take out survey or leave the appearance in production testing process, and current equipment can only single sample go on one by one when slicing, when taking out survey or leaving the appearance in batches, need constantly change the appearance, stop the machine, and is inefficient. Therefore, the design of a wire cutting clamp which is convenient for a plurality of samples to be fixed and sampled simultaneously is a technical problem which needs to be solved at present.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ention will be described in detail with reference to the accompanying drawings. It should be understood that the description is intended to be illustrative only and is not intended to limit the scope of the present invention. Moreover, in the following description, descriptions of well-known structures and techniques are omitted so as to not unnecessarily obscure the concepts of the present invention.
The specific implementation mode is as follows: shown in a combined figure 1-3, comprises a base 1, a steel bar clamp 2 and a steel ball clamp 3; a steel bar clamp 2 is arranged on one side of the base 1; a steel ball clamp 3 is arranged on the other side of the base 1; the steel bar clamp 2 comprises: the device comprises a circular boss 201, a limiting base plate 202, a fixing nut 203 and a fastening bolt 204; a circular boss 201 is arranged on one side of the base 1; a limiting bottom plate 202 is arranged on the lower side of the circular boss 201; the limiting bottom plate 202 is welded with the base 1; a circular notch 205 corresponding to the circular boss 201 is arranged on the upper side of the limit bottom plate 202; an installation gap 206 is reserved between the limiting bottom plate 202 and the circular boss 201; a fixing nut 203 is arranged on the upper side of the circular boss 201; the fixing nut 203 is welded with the base 1; a fastening bolt 204 is connected with the internal thread of the fixing nut 203; the steel ball clamp 3 comprises a fixed arc plate 301 and a movable arc plate 302; the fixed arc plate 301 is fixedly welded with the base 1; a movable arc plate 302 is arranged on the other side of the fixed arc plate 301; a threaded rod 303 is welded on one side of the movable arc plate 302, which is far away from the fixed arc plate 301; the threaded rod 303 is in threaded connection with the base 1; the steel bar clamp 2 is provided with 4 circular bosses 201; a handle 304 is arranged on one side of the threaded rod 303 far away from the movable arc plate 302; the inner sides of the fixed arc plate 301 and the movable arc plate 302 are provided with concave arc surfaces 305.
During the use, combine shown in fig. 1-3, before needs carry out cutting operation to rod iron and steel ball, insert circular boss 201 in the hollow rod iron, make the rod iron downside be located installation gap 206, rotatory fastening bolt 204 this moment, make fastening bolt 204 withstand the rod iron, make the rod iron more stable, owing to set up have a plurality of circular sand grips, through repeating this operation, can accomplish fixedly with a plurality of rod irons, then put into the steel ball that needs the cutting between two indent cambered surfaces 305, through rotatory handle 304, make removal arc plate 302 extrusion steel ball, it is fixed with the steel ball to guarantee to remove arc plate 302 and fixed arc plate 301, can carry out the cutting operation this moment, can cut rod iron and steel ball simultaneously, and can carry out the cutting operation to many rod irons simultaneously.
